About The Company:A highly regarded creative organisation that works across the luxury fashion and beauty industries, they partner with an impressive array of clients and talent to produce content for major outlets.The Role:My client is looking to hire a CFO who can work over a small group of creative companies, act as a strategic financial expert, helping the business navigate complex financial landscapes and make informed decisions to drive growth and success.  Key Responsibilities:
  • Financial Planning and Analysis - Developing comprehensive financial plans.
  • Strategic Planning and Execution - Contributing financial expertise to the planning process, translating strategic goals.
  • Advising on Mergers and Acquisitions - Playing a critical role in mergers and acquisitions, securing funding, and making key recommendations.
  • Scaling and Succession Planning - Guiding the company through scaling processes, ensuring financial infrastructure is robust.
Desirable Skills:
  • Qualified Accountant (CIMA, ACCA, ACA).
  • Experience in fashion or luxury retail environments.
  • Proven experience of leading a Finance Team.
  • Demonstrable knowledge of growing a business through M&A processes.
Benefits:
  • Hybrid working pattern – 3 in/ 2 out.
  • Strong remuneration package
  • Enhanced pension
